黑狐家游戏

数据仓需要哪些技术参数,构建高效数据仓库,不可或缺的核心技术解析

欧气 0 0

本文目录导读:

  1. 数据仓库架构技术
  2. 数据采集与处理技术
  3. 数据存储与管理技术
  4. 数据查询与分析技术
  5. 数据安全与隐私保护技术

随着大数据时代的到来,数据仓库作为企业数据分析的重要工具,越来越受到重视,一个高效的数据仓库不仅能帮助企业挖掘数据价值,还能为企业决策提供有力支持,构建一个功能完善、性能优越的数据仓库并非易事,需要运用一系列先进的技术,本文将详细介绍数据仓库所需的核心技术,助力企业打造高效的数据仓库。

数据仓库架构技术

1、星型模型与雪花模型

星型模型和雪花模型是数据仓库中常用的数据模型,星型模型结构简单,便于查询,但数据冗余较大;雪花模型通过分解维度表,降低了数据冗余,但查询性能相对较低,根据实际需求,选择合适的模型对数据仓库性能至关重要。

数据仓需要哪些技术参数,构建高效数据仓库,不可或缺的核心技术解析

图片来源于网络,如有侵权联系删除

2、多级缓存技术

数据仓库中的多级缓存技术主要包括内存缓存、磁盘缓存和SSD缓存,通过合理配置缓存策略,可以有效提高数据仓库的查询性能。

数据采集与处理技术

1、ETL(Extract-Transform-Load)技术

ETL技术是数据仓库的核心技术之一,负责从源系统抽取数据、转换数据以及加载到目标数据仓库,ETL工具如Informatica、Talend等,能够帮助企业实现高效的数据采集与处理。

2、数据清洗技术

数据清洗是数据仓库建设过程中的重要环节,通过对数据进行清洗,去除重复、错误和缺失的数据,提高数据质量,常用的数据清洗技术包括数据去重、缺失值处理、异常值处理等。

数据存储与管理技术

1、分布式数据库技术

数据仓需要哪些技术参数,构建高效数据仓库,不可或缺的核心技术解析

图片来源于网络,如有侵权联系删除

分布式数据库技术可以实现数据仓库的横向扩展,提高系统性能,如Hadoop、Spark等分布式计算框架,能够满足大规模数据存储与处理需求。

2、NoSQL数据库技术

NoSQL数据库如MongoDB、Cassandra等,具有高可用性、高性能和可扩展性等特点,适用于处理非结构化和半结构化数据。

数据查询与分析技术

1、SQL查询优化技术

SQL查询优化是提高数据仓库查询性能的关键,通过对SQL语句的优化,减少查询过程中的数据访问次数,提高查询效率。

2、数据可视化技术

数据可视化技术可以将数据以图形、图表等形式呈现,帮助用户直观地了解数据趋势和关联关系,如Tableau、Power BI等可视化工具,为数据仓库应用提供了强大的支持。

数据仓需要哪些技术参数,构建高效数据仓库,不可或缺的核心技术解析

图片来源于网络,如有侵权联系删除

数据安全与隐私保护技术

1、数据加密技术

数据加密技术可以保障数据在存储、传输和处理过程中的安全性,常用的加密算法有AES、RSA等。

2、访问控制技术

访问控制技术可以限制用户对数据仓库的访问权限,防止数据泄露,如基于角色的访问控制(RBAC)、基于属性的访问控制(ABAC)等。

构建一个高效的数据仓库需要运用多种先进技术,企业应根据自身业务需求,选择合适的技术方案,不断提升数据仓库的性能和稳定性,通过本文的介绍,相信读者对数据仓库所需的核心技术有了更深入的了解。

标签: #数据仓需要哪些技术

黑狐家游戏
  • 评论列表

留言评论